Description

Fuji Cutlery Ryutoku FC-580 Japanese Nakiri Kitchen Knife

The Nakiri is a traditional Japanese knife designed specifically for cutting vegetables and fruit. Its straight blade and ergonomic magnolia handle make it a comfortable and well-balanced tool for use in the kitchen.

The weight and size are carefully balanced. It fits naturally in the hand and allows for precise control over the thickness of the cut.

High-hardness stainless steel blade

The blade is made of stainless steel with a hardness of 57–58 HRC and is finely ground to #5000. The double bevel ensures a symmetrical and clean cut.

The 1.7 mm thickness makes the blade thin enough for precise work without sacrificing strength.

The Fuji Cutlery Brand and Japanese Traditions

Tojiro is a Japanese company with a history dating back to 1955, when it began production with a stainless steel fruit knife. Their philosophy is summed up in the words “More than just sharpness”—a knife should not only cut well, but also feel like a natural extension of the hand.

The manufacturing process combines modern machinery with hand-finished details and strict quality control. The laminated steel used is forged using the same method as that for traditional Japanese katana swords made from tamahagane.

Tips for Knife Maintenance

  • Cut on a plastic or wooden cutting board—not bamboo, not glass, not porcelain
  • Do not apply lateral force or twist the cutting edge
  • Sharpen regularly—it's easier to keep a blade sharp than to have to do a major sharpening after it has become severely dull.
  • Do not wash in the dishwasher
  • This knife is intended solely for use in the kitchen

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a Nakiri knife used for?

The Nakiri is a traditional Japanese knife designed specifically for cutting vegetables and fruit. The straight blade allows for clean, even cuts, and controlling the thickness of the slices is much easier compared to a utility knife. It is suitable for root vegetables, leafy vegetables, and fruits of various sizes.
